Family and Social Background
We have been performing hereditary priestly duties at Ganga Godavari, Ramkund, Nashik, following our ancestral tradition. We have been carrying out priestly duties since the time of our ancestors, beginning with Bapu Bhat Panchakshari, even prior to our great-grandfather.
We maintain a record of yajmans (patrons) from Gujarat, preserved for approximately 150 years. We represent the sixth generation performing priestly duties at Ramkund. Yajmans visit us from across India. In accordance with our ancestral tradition, we perform various religious rituals.
These include asthi visarjan, dashkriya (tenth-day rites), panchak shanti, tripad shanti, terava (thirteenth-day rites), annual shraddha, pitrudosh nivaran shanti, narayan bali, tripindi, and mahalaya shraddha. We also perform various shanti rituals such as janan shanti, janan yoga shanti, kalsarpa shanti, and mangal shanti.
Purohit at Trimbakeshwar
Trimbakeshwar, located near Nashik in Maharashtra, is one of the twelve Jyotirlingas of Lord Shiva and is considered one of the most sacred pilgrimage sites in India. We conduct Vedic rituals, Shanti ceremonies, and ancestral rites as per traditional scriptures.
